Bouvet Island has no permanent population, no economy, and no monetary system — it is a Norwegian nature reserve in the South Atlantic, roughly 1,700 kilometres from the nearest inhabited land. Any banknote attributed to it is a fantasy or souvenir item with no official status. Norway, the administering power, has never authorized banknote issuance for the territory.
Collectors should treat this as a novelty piece, not a circulating or legally issued note.
